TAYLORSVILLE, Utah (April 10, 2021) – The No. 2 Salt Lake Community College softball team enjoyed a warm weekend at home, with SLCC's win total being the only thing blooming more fiercely than the Wasatch Front foliage.
Â
SLCC swept a doubleheader against Colorado Northwestern, earning victories of 22-6 and 16-1 to move to 8-0 against the Lady Spartans this season. Salt Lake is now 33-1 overall and 23-1 in Scenic West play.
Â
Salt Lake will travel to play at Southern Idaho next weekend.
Â
Salt Lake 22, Colorado Northwestern 6: Several big innings lifted SLCC to a run-rule win in the day's opening game.
Â
Savannah Heaton hit a three-run home run early on to boost SLCC, while
Rylie Bennett added a two-run home run in the third inning. Bennett hit two home runs in the third inning, with Heaton also adding another home run in the frame.
Hola Nakayama also hit a solo home run in the second inning.Â
Â
Salt Lake posted 17 hits in the game, with Heaton going 3-of-4 at the plate to lead the Bruins. Bennett went 2-of-4 with a team-high five RBI's.
Nya Laing earned the victory in the pitching circle.Â
Â
Salt Lake 16, Colorado Northwestern 1: SLCC scored 11 runs in the opening inning, powering to a run-rule victory.
Â
Mackenzy Richins hit a two-run home run in the first inning to help power the Bruins to the early lead, part of the 15 hits that Salt Lake posted in the win.
Rylie Bennett was 2-of-2 with a pair of RBI's, while Richins also had two RBI's. Salt Lake had five players with multi-RBI games, with
Josee Haycock posting a team-high four RBI's.Â
